The next decade is upon us and I'm chuffed to be releasing my first podcast of the new year, accompanied by one very brilliant Alev Lenz.Alev is first of all, podcast gold - you'll love hearing from her all about her music in this episode.She is an expert builder of atmospheric sound worlds with song & storytelling at its heart.We discuss a track of hers featured on the hit TV show Black Mirror (i'm sure you're all familiar), a turning point in her career and how that triggered a small series of events that shaped her recently released album '3' on SA Recordings. It's an incredibly powerful album and it heavily features the pioneering vocal ensemble, Roomful of Teeth.You can get hold of the album here if you like what you here (hint: the vinyl comes in a lovely blue)There is an unusual dimension to the release of this album, it can be bought alongside a sample library that is built from the DNA of the album itself, find out more within the pod.Alev has collaborated with the internationally celebrated sitarist and composer, Anoushka Shankar over a number of years.
